Lengthening days in Florence through June 1852

Across June 1852, daylight in Florence, Italy grows — the month opens with 15h 13m of daylight and closes with 15h 24m (a swing of about 11 minutes). Day length shifts by about 3 minutes each week.

The earliest sunrise falls at 04:22 on June 9 and the latest at 04:26 on June 30, while sunset ranges from 19:39 on June 1 to 19:50 on June 21.

The longest day of the month is June 19 at 15h 27m, the shortest June 1 at 15h 13m. It falls in northern-hemisphere summer, which sets the overall pattern of these times. Handy for photographers, early risers, travellers and anyone timing their day to the light in Florence.
